We Have to Open the Casket! Imagine What Sweet Cuffs Could Be in There!

Posted in Anime Seasons, JoJo's Year, Spring 2014, Text Articles with tags , , , , , , on 2014/04/10 by OnePixelJumpMan

Have you ever wanted to know what it was like for Dio at the bottom of the ocean? Who wouldn’t? Sentinel Co. has your back with their new DIO casket. It’s a small figure piece at 190mm done with the excellent detail you’d expect from a Sentinel product all the way down to a very nice “DIO” plaque latch. But is it only a solid box?

No, you can open it and put in your very nice jewelry. It is an accessory box. The display makes it look like a ring box, but you can put cuffs and all other sorts in there.

On top of that, there are two color versions. This is the standard version, but there is also the Undersea version that’s colored to match a more deep ocean tone.

Both versions are ¥4,104, and you can get them both from Union-Creative (Standard Version / Undersea Version).

SILE- LE- LE- LE- LENCE! Stardust Crusaders Themed Headphone Jack Covers

Posted in JoJo's Year, Text Articles with tags , , , , , , , , on 2013/12/28 by OnePixelJumpMan

Merchandising is at its best when it makes as little sense as possible. When thinking of a product of yours to make, consider the functions it could have. You could have a figurine, but what happens when your primary market needs to make sure that dust doesn’t get in the jack for their headphones? What if they want to go around pretending their phone has the ability to summon ghost muscle man that can stop time or pull others into a void of nothingness?

Some people do manage to think of those possibilities, though, and thus we now have Stardust Crusaders themed headphone jack covers. They come in packs of 12 with a gold and silver version each of Star Platinum, The World, Silver Chariot, Iggy, and Cream with two hidden types. It’s likely that the hidden types will be consistent and they just want to leave it as an added bonus, but it may also be possible for them to be different per package. Maybe want to keep those trading lines open.

The package deal is currently available for preorder from AmiAmi for ¥6,830 intending to launch in late March.
